Market Overview


The Global In Vitro Fertilization (IVF) Devices Market was valued at USD 1,883.4 million in 2023 and is expected to reach USD 4,247.5 million by 2031 while growing at a CAGR of 10.7% during the forecast period (2024-2031).

In-Vitro Fertilization (IVF) is a product of fertilization process sperms and an egg outside the body, making it the most common assisted reproductive technology. It is widely used in managing infertility, and since its breakthrough, IVF accounts for 1.6% and 4.5% of all live births in the United States and Europe, respectively, marking rapid progress in the field of reproductive endocrinology/infertility (REI).


Continuous advancements in medical technology and the increasing prevalence of infertility propel the in vitro fertilization (IVF) devices market. Nonetheless, obstacles like the high costs of IVF procedures and limited accessibility and awareness may impede market expansion.

Global In Vitro Fertilization (IVF) Devices Market: Regional Analysis


Based on region, the market is divided into six regions including North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, Middle East, and Africa. In 2023, Europe dominated the market with the highest market share, while North America is expected to grow with the highest CAGR during the forecast period (2024 – 2031).

Competitive Landscape


Some of the key players operating in the market are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c, The Cooper Companies, Inc, Vitrolife Group, Hamilton Thorne, Rocket Medical, Cook Group, Fujifilm Holdings Corporation, Kitazato Corporation, Esco Lifesciences Group, and Merck KGaA.
